OT Marcus Gilbert would rather play the left side than the right, where he started most of 2011 and now in OTAs finds himself again. "I was kind of bummed out about it," Gilbert said Thursday of second-round choice Mike Adams being given the left-tackle slot. "I just can't control what the coach has in mind."
